Objective of the campaign
Despite the growing number of New Zealanders diagnosed every year, blood cancers and related conditions have very low awareness levels. They're complex and difficult to understand and this means, all too often, even patients choose to stay silent about them amongst their friends, workmates and even families.
So, as part of Blood Cancer Awareness Week (November 4-10), LBC challenged us to create a campaign to really get all New Zealanders talking about blood cancers, so they're better understood.
